  • Page 6: Preparation/Spreading

    Operating Instructions Preparation/Spreading PREPARATION Inspect your spreader before each use. Make sure the Wheels turn easily, and the Spinner rotates clockwise when the spreader is pushed. The Hopper should be clean and free from cracks. The Gate should open and close smoothly. Before filling the hopper, make sure that the Gate Lever is in the“0”position (fully forward) and the Gate is closed.
  • Page 7: Calibration Instructions

    Calibration Instructions All seed and fertilizer mixtures, regardless of physical similarities, flow and spread differently. Therefore, your spreader should be calibrated specifically for each material you are spreading. Use the charts in this manual to record calibration data for your spreader for materials you commonly use.

  • Page 10: Maintenance

    Maintenance CLEANING AND MAINTENANCE Clean material out of hopper after each use. Rinse and dry the spreader after each use. Before operating make sure the tires have the recommended pressure – 25 psi (1.72 bar) Periodically check all fasteners for tightness. Periodically clean and lubricate parts.
